Kind Water Systems E-3000 Whole House Salt-Free Softener and Filter Combo
Kind’s flagship: sediment, carbon and salt-free conditioning in one 15 GPM wall-mounted manifold, no tanks.

The E-3000 is the model most buyers comparing Kind against SpringWell or Aquasana are actually looking at, and it is the one the rest of the range is priced around. Its strongest attribute is packaging: filtration and scale control in a single 29 by 23.25 by 8 inch wall-mounted manifold at a full 15 GPM, with no floor tanks, no electricity, no drain and no brine discharge, which is a genuinely different proposition from the two-tank systems it competes with. The carbon block earns NSF/ANSI 42 for chlorine, taste and odour, and materials safety is covered by 61 and 372. Its weakest attribute is the gap between marketing and certification. Kind advertises 155-plus contaminants reduced and 88 percent scale reduction, and holds no NSF/ANSI 53, 401 or P473 certification to support any of it, so those figures are manufacturer-stated. Filter life is a time window rather than a gallon rating, which makes running cost hard to compare directly against a system that publishes capacity. Salt-free conditioning also means hardness minerals stay in the water; a hardness test after installation reads the same as before, and the water will not feel soft. What the buyer trades away is certified health-effects performance and true hardness removal, in exchange for by far the easiest installation and smallest footprint at this capacity.
- Three stages in one wall-mounted manifold with no floor tanks and no drain line
- NSF/ANSI 42 certified carbon block for chlorine, taste and odour reduction
- Full 15 GPM at 1 in NPT, rated for homes up to five bathrooms
- No salt, no electricity and zero wastewater
- Handles hardness to 1,282 PPM or 75 grains per gallon
- Lifetime limited warranty plus a 120-day satisfaction guarantee
- No NSF/ANSI 53, 401 or P473, so the 155-plus contaminant claim is manufacturer-stated
- Salt-free conditioning does not remove hardness, so post-install hardness tests read unchanged
- Filter life quoted as 6 to 12 months with no gallon capacity published
- Proprietary cartridges lock ongoing cost to Kind's own pricing
- Discounted near-continuously, so the list price shown is rarely what a buyer pays
The E-3000 is Kind's best-selling city-water system, a three-stage wall-mounted unit combining a 20-inch 5-micron pleated sediment cartridge, a carbon block and salt-free conditioning media. It runs 15 GPM on 1 in NPT, needs no electricity, produces no wastewater and tolerates hardness to 75 grains per gallon. Certified components cover NSF/ANSI 42, 61 and 372, and Kind states manufacture in the USA and Italy. Cartridges are hand-swapped every six to twelve months.
